Methylated spirits

Denatured alcohol or methylated spirits is ethanol that has additives to make it more poisonous or unpalatable and, thus, undrinkable. In some cases it is also dyed. Denatured alcohol is used as a solvent and as fuel for spirit burners and camping stoves. Denaturing alcohol does not chemically alter the ethanol molecule. Rather, the ethanol is mixed with other chemicals.
